The cheapest way to get from Ojai to Redlands is to drive which costs $25 - $40 and takes 2h 41m.
The fastest way to get from Ojai to Redlands is to drive which takes 2h 41m and costs $25 - $40.
The distance between Ojai and Redlands is 157 miles. The road distance is 140.7 miles.
The best way to get from Ojai to Redlands without a car is to train which takes 5h 44m and costs $100 - $140.
It takes approximately 5h 44m to get from Ojai to Redlands,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Ojai to Redlands is 141 miles. It takes approximately 2h 41m to drive from Ojai to Redlands.
